DEPARTMENT OF MATHEMATICS

PROGRAMME NAME BACHELOR OF MATHEMATICS

PROGRAMME OUTCOMES
The overall aim of B.Sc. Mathematics is to
PO1: develop broad and balanced knowledge and understanding of definitions, concepts,
principles and theorems.
PO2: enhance the ability of learners to apply the knowledge and skills acquired by them
during the programme to solve specific theoretical and applied problems in mathematics.
PO3: provide students/learners sufficient knowledge and skills enabling them to undertake
further studies in mathematics and its allied areas on multiple disciplines concerned with
mathematics.

SUBJECT CODE: SM21A SUBJECT NAME: ALGEBRA


CO1 Basic ideas on Theory of Equations, Matrices and Theory of Numbers
CO2 Knowledge to solve theoretical and applied problems
CO3 To learn divisibility of integers and congruence relations
CO4 To learn eigen values and eigen vectors of matrix
CO5 To develop fluency in working with linear equations
